IDF skeptical that man stopped Kassam with body

The IDF's Southern Command received a report on Monday, channeled from the Palestinian Authority's Gaza district coordinating office, stating that a Palestinian was seriously wounded when he placed his own body in front of the Kassam rocket launched late Monday night from the Gaza Strip into the western Negev. The IDF said it was skeptical of the report. The army reported Monday night that the rocket was fired from an area between Beit Hanoun and Beit Lahiya in northern Gaza.
